Originally Posted by rvaquino
ok, so i for sure need the clip, might need the connector rod and door actuator?

I tried searching for part #'s but could not find any. Does anyone have them?



I know, it has been a really good week to ride around with my windows down. Luckily I decided to roll them down in the parking lot and not on the freeway!



Ya, i did it those 3 times and that was it! I was soo scared i was gonna break my window.

Alright, so far im looking to replace the clip, and maybe the rod + actuator.
the connector rod is part of the actuator. They don't sell em separately. Gazi has em for 90 shipped or so. Dealer wants almost $300.
